Is Vitiligo curable?
From last 2months i m suffering from white patches on hands and legs and i have 1year baby boy. I feeds him. Will it affect my baby?

Greetings. Vitiligo is an autoimmune disorder. It may have exacerbations/ improvements depending on various factors. This is a treatable condition, however, cure may not be promised. That is – the pigmentation may be attempted to be improved to normal with the help of medications. If the disease is active, you’ll need immunosuppressive medication to control its spread. Also phototherapy is a good form of therapy to improve your condition. IT WILL NOT SPREAD TO YOUR BABY BY TOUCHING OR FEED ING IT - SO DONT WORRY - TAKE GOOD CARE OF YOURSELF AND YOUR BABY. Kindly see a qualified dermatologist near you. Warm regards.
